Essential fatty acid deficiency in renal failure: can supplements really help?

Summary
Abnormal fatty acid metabolism in chronic renal failure patients can cause health issues. Fish oil supplementation may improve hematocrit and reduce itching by lowering inflammatory prostaglandin PGE2 levels.

Background:
- Abnormal fatty acid metabolism is linked to complications in chronic renal failure (CRF).
- These complications include pruritus, infections, anemia, and impaired wound healing.
- Prostaglandin E2 (PGE2) is a key inflammatory mediator implicated in CRF pathophysiology.
Purpose of the Study:
- To investigate the effects of different oil interventions on fatty acid profiles and clinical outcomes in hemodialysis patients.
- To determine if fish oil can modulate levels of the proinflammatory prostaglandin PGE2.
- To assess the impact of oil supplementation on hematocrit and pruritus.
Main Methods:
- A double-blind, randomized controlled trial involving hemodialysis patients.
- Intervention groups received fish oil, olive oil, or safflower oil.
- Measurements included fatty acid profiles, PGE2 levels, hematocrit, and patient-reported pruritus symptoms.
Main Results:
- Fish oil intervention was associated with decreased levels of prostaglandin PGE2.
- Significant changes in the fatty acid profile were observed with fish oil.
- Improvements in hematocrit levels and patient-reported pruritus were noted in the fish oil group.
- Olive oil and safflower oil did not show the same beneficial effects on PGE2 or pruritus.
Conclusions:
- Fish oil supplementation may be a beneficial intervention for hemodialysis patients with abnormal fatty acid metabolism.
- Modulating fatty acid profiles and reducing PGE2 may alleviate symptoms like pruritus and improve hematological parameters.
- Further research is warranted to confirm these findings and elucidate mechanisms.
